Well, having quite some synths with high bandwidth, I prefere to use an EQ to narrow the bandwidth of a synths signal, some synths even have built in ones that can be saved with the sound, like the AN200 and I guess the AN1x can do that too... Anyway, it depends of the rest of the mix what frequencies you realy need, a high hiss pad sound at the end of the sprectre can just round up the middle and higher frequencies, if there's room for it. In other cases deep down pads an rising basses can be fine, if the music is not kick based... I know mixing is less work if the synth is a bit specialised and limited frequency wise, but it imho limits sounddesign greatly...
